The beloved Scranton, Pennsylvania outfit have announced a run of Australian headline dates this November, marking their first trip back down under in three years – and yep, they’re also folding in a very special Melbourne appearance supporting Touché Amoré’s exclusive Australian celebration of Stage Four’s 10th anniversary.

For well over a decade, Tigers Jaw have occupied a weirdly perfect sweet spot between emo, indie and post-hardcore, the kind of band whose songs somehow feel equally suited to crying in your bedroom, screaming in a packed venue, or driving nowhere in particular while overthinking your entire life. Their influence stretches across generations of alternative music, with their signature dual vocals, emotional precision and understated cool becoming a blueprint for countless bands that followed.
This return arrives off the back of their seventh studio album Lost on You, released earlier this year via Hopeless Records. Reuniting with producer Will Yip (Turnstile, Movements) at Pennsylvania’s famed Studio 4, the record finds Tigers Jaw doing what they’ve always done best: writing songs that feel immediate, intimate and quietly devastating while still somehow sounding bigger than ever.
Australian fans can expect a set balancing new material with the songs that helped cement Tigers Jaw as one of emo’s most enduring cult faves – the sort of catalogue that’s accumulated emotional significance for people over years, breakups, friendships and approximately one million late-night headphone walks.
The run kicks off in Perth before heading east, including two Melbourne appearances – one alongside Touché Amoré at Forum Theatre and another intimate headline date at Howler.

Tigers Jaw Australian Tour 2026
- Tuesday 10 November — Lynotts Lounge, Perth
- Thursday 12 November — Crowbar, Sydney
- Friday 13 November — Forum, Melbourne*
- Saturday 14 November — Howler, Melbourne
- Sunday 15 November — The Brightside, Brisbane
*Supporting Touché Amoré
